| gouthamr | the RISC-V SIG proposal is moving along as well.. it was good to specifically note what the group will be focusing on.. the details are in this thread: | 17:10 |
| gouthamr | #link https://lists.openstack.org/archives/list/openstack-discuss@lists.openstack.org/thread/UK2YYNPXC3BGZM3IWHYM6XYNQXHPD57C/ ([riscv-sig] Proposal for a New SIG: Accelerating RISC-V Adoption in OpenInfra) | 17:10 |
| gouthamr | and this proposal: | 17:10 |
| gouthamr | #link https://review.opendev.org/c/openstack/governance/+/988896 | 17:10 |
| noonedeadpunk | I really hope this will work out on long run ^ | 17:11 |
| gouthamr | yeah.. the largest impediment i see is language barriers.. i'm hoping there's some drive to bridge that within the group | 17:12 |
| noonedeadpunk | and timezones, and I have some historical conerns when with simmilar affiliation folks were dissapearing as fast as popping up. | 17:13 |
| fungi | differences in preferred communication channels/venues have also posed similar challenges in the past | 17:14 |
| mnasiadka | Well, getting arm64 in current state took a lot of time and investment - so risc-v is going to take at least the same | 17:14 |
| noonedeadpunk | and now we're at point when CI for arm barely has resources afaik | 17:15 |
| fungi | (generously donated by a university) | 17:15 |
| gouthamr | ack, this SIG proposal comes with a promise of CI testing resources | 17:15 |
| noonedeadpunk | and there used to be multiple providers for arm, and I won't expect nobody else to step in with risc-v soonish tbh | 17:15 |
| noonedeadpunk | but dunno | 17:15 |
| noonedeadpunk | So I am sceptical about prespectives, but still think we should try out and find out... | 17:17 |
| spotz[m] | I wonder if we could get some from Ampere? | 17:17 |
| gouthamr | good questions to post on the gerrit review though.. i've asked them to organize on IRC and the mailing list... my excuse was that it'll help them meet others in the community than work in silo.. | 17:17 |
| spotz[m] | I think they have Arm could be wrong | 17:17 |
| fungi | there may also be a chicken-and-egg challenge with the risc-v resource donation, in that opendev can really only consume resources supplied by an openstack cloud api, and if it's not possible to serve risc-v hypervisor hosts with nova yet... | 17:18 |
| mnasiadka | Not even mentioning any deployment project or devstack supporting risc-v ;-) | 17:18 |
| gouthamr | ack.. so they need to chat with you folks to figure out that part | 17:18 |
| fungi | spotz[m]: the challenges with arm resources have proven not to be sourcing the hardware, but finding a place to host it and someone to manage an open stack cloud on top of it | 17:19 |
| spotz[m] | ahh | 17:19 |
| noonedeadpunk | well... if they do some downstream patch to nova | 17:20 |
| noonedeadpunk | which once hardware added to CI they can propose upstream.... | 17:20 |
| noonedeadpunk | I think this would be the only way to sort out chicken-egg | 17:20 |
| fungi | when we lost our other arm providers it was because the company maintaining the cloud lost interest, or the company providing a place to host the hardware decided to stop | 17:21 |
| fungi | (facility space, power, cooling, networking, warm bodies...) | 17:22 |
| gouthamr | worth a discussion with the SIG? i think you folks have context/knowledge on this that we (the TC) can't provide | 17:22 |
| fungi | yes, though it's likely they've already worked out how to plumb risc-v servers into nova, in which case it may be fine | 17:23 |
| mnasiadka | If there’s a company that wants to source the hardware - StackHPC has a cloud in Iceland and we’re willing to accept that hardware (fund rack space and power) and make it available - just FYI | 17:23 |
| mnasiadka | (We have some old aarch64 nodes that I’m planning to make available for OpenDev, but it might not be a speed improvement over the current university resources) | 17:24 |
| fungi | mnasiadka: thanks, i'll keep that in mind for sure | 17:24 |
| fungi | ampere has offered us hardware in the past and we've had no way to utilize it short of getting them to donate it to osuosl | 17:24 |
| gouthamr | apart from linking this to the governance proposal, what action items can we take to further this? | 17:26 |
| fungi | get the sig request approved and encourage them to get involved in the parts of openstack where it makes sense to them, and separately figure out if there are options to do first-party/upstream testing but that's likely to take a while to sort out | 17:27 |
